We pulled a 2008 Alamos Malbec from Argentina out of the basement the othernight. It retails for about $13, clocks in at 13.5% alcohol by volume, and hada Diam closure. On first sniff I was turned off by this wine. It smelled overlysweet and what people often call “spoofy.” I got sweetened black fruit, sweetoak, sweet berries, chocolate, and pepper. The nose was so sweet smelling. Ishould come up with a better descriptor, but really, sweet is all I have tooffer. In the mouth the fruit showed a bit tarter, but not much. Blackberry,black cherry, and oak are all I got on the palate. I found it to be simple andtoo sweet for my taste. NMS.
